4. Focusing Only on Mortgage Rates Without Reading the Fine Print
Sure, a low mortgage rate sounds great. But is it really the best option for you?
What many don’t realize:
A lower rate might come with hidden restrictions—like steep prepayment penalties, tight renewal terms, or long amortization periods that hurt you in the long run.
Smart buyers go deeper:
Take the time to understand your full mortgage terms—not just the headline rate. Lenders should offer you transparent, tailored advice, and if they don’t, you could end up with limited flexibility when your financial situation evolves.
